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"large volume of users" is correct and commonly used in written English.
It refers to a significant number of people who use a particular service or product. Example: "The social media platform boasts a large volume of users across the globe."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
When referring to a group of users, ensure that the term accurately represents the user base's size and characteristics. If the diversity of the group is important, consider using "broad spectrum of users" instead of simply "large volume of users".
Common error
Avoid using "large volume of users" when the quality or engagement of the users is more relevant than the sheer number. Consider phrases that highlight user activity, satisfaction, or loyalty if those aspects are more important.

More alternative expressions(10)
Phrases that express similar concepts, ordered by semantic similarity:
substantial user base
Replaces "volume" with "base" to emphasize the collective group of users.
extensive user community
Highlights the community aspect of users rather than just their quantity.
significant user population
Uses "population" to denote the group of users, implying a demographic.
considerable number of users
Emphasizes the quantity using "considerable" instead of "large volume".
vast audience of users
Shifts focus to the audience aspect, suitable for content or media platforms.
broad spectrum of users
Highlights the diversity among the users, not just the quantity.
high concentration of users
Focuses on the density or accumulation of users in a specific area or platform.
widespread user adoption
Emphasizes the rate at which users are adopting a technology or service.
massive influx of users
Suggests a sudden and significant increase in the number of users.
expanded user pool
Highlights that the set of users has become bigger.
FAQs
How can I use "large volume of users" in a sentence?
You might say, "The platform attracts a "large volume of users" due to its user-friendly interface and extensive features."
What are some alternatives to saying "large volume of users"?
You can use alternatives like "substantial user base", "extensive user community", or "significant user population" depending on the specific context.
When is it more appropriate to use "substantial user base" instead of "large volume of users"?
While "large volume of users" focuses on quantity, "substantial user base" is more suitable when highlighting the stability, loyalty, or value of the user group.
Is there a difference between "large number of users" and "large volume of users"?
While both are generally interchangeable, "large volume of users" might subtly suggest a measurement or tracking of user activity and data associated with their use, whereas "large number of users" simply states the quantity.
